Types of Horse Drugs in Equine Pharmacy

1. Antibiotics and Antimicrobials

Used to combat bacterial infections, antibiotics such as penicillins, tetracyclines, and cephalosporins are vital in treating conditions like septicemia, pneumonia, and wound infections. Careful dosage and administration are crucial to prevent resistance development.

2. Anti-inflammatory and Pain Relief Medications

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) like phenylbutazone and flunixin meglumine are frequently used to manage pain and inflammation associated with musculoskeletal injuries or chronic conditions such as lameness and arthritis.

3. Vaccines

Prevention is better than cure; vaccines protect horses from serious infectious diseases like tetanus, equine influenza, and herpesvirus. Proper vaccination protocols form a core part of responsible equine medicine.

4. Sedatives and Tranquilizers

Medications such as acepromazine and xylazine are used to calm horses during veterinary procedures or transport, ensuring safety and reducing stress.

5. Endocrine and Hormonal Treatments

These include medications like pergolide for Cushing’s disease or deslorelin implants for reproductive management, tailored to specific endocrine dysfunctions.

6. Nutritional Supplements and Performance Aids

High-quality supplements such as joint protectants, electrolytes, and vitamins support overall health, stamina, and recovery in performance horses.

Choosing the Right Horse Drugs: Critical Considerations

Administering horse drugs accurately is paramount. Here are key considerations to guide the selection process:

  1. Diagnosis Accuracy: Ensure that the underlying condition is correctly diagnosed before selecting a medication.
  2. Proper Dosage and Administration: Follow veterinarian prescriptions and label instructions meticulously.
  3. Withdrawal Times: For performance horses, adhere to withdrawal periods to avoid any medication residues in meat or milk.
  4. Monitoring and Follow-up: Observe the horse's response and adjust treatment if necessary.
  5. Storage and Handling: Store medicines as per guidelines to maintain potency and prevent degradation.

The Importance of Professional Oversight in Horse Drug Administration

While the availability of effective horse drugs is essential, their success depends heavily on proper oversight by trained veterinarians or equine health professionals. Self-medicating or incorrect usage can lead to suboptimal results, drug residues, or even severe health complications.

Working closely with a veterinarian ensures that medication choices are appropriate, doses are correct, and treatment protocols are optimized to your horse's specific needs. Moreover, veterinary supervision ensures compliance with legal regulations and promotes responsible medication use.
